Output c59dd873fbd8498b77dfc187efecfd290caa71c19d5b2667272afd8bb6964d18:1

value
689543
script pubkey
OP_0 OP_PUSHBYTES_20 1005358337369910f85aa6e926f8e6fdd81c18e9
address
bc1qzqzntqehx6v3p7z65m5jd78xlhvpcx8fspdeda
transaction
c59dd873fbd8498b77dfc187efecfd290caa71c19d5b2667272afd8bb6964d18
spent
false